What I do at Capital B 

I cover the multiple entities of Gary’s political and governmental landscape, including the Mayor’s Office, Common Council and numerous decision-making bodies within the city. I also monitor how the city is affected by decisions made at the county and state levels. But above all, I track how all political and bureaucratic decisions impact the lives of the people of Gary.
